Transaction 642671e54407615b8b4ed1403e9f3d88846647af68a1e4b0081bf99e1da1199a
1 Input
2 Outputs
- 642671e54407615b8b4ed1403e9f3d88846647af68a1e4b0081bf99e1da1199a:0
- 642671e54407615b8b4ed1403e9f3d88846647af68a1e4b0081bf99e1da1199a:1
value 43840229
address 1FdheXumLRtMHfikhNedkEB4WjAWdFPB5Q
value 42196681820
address 19xW5zFTezSGsd1y96cTbXr3N5F2XfWzZC